AMERICAN RED CROSS  ~ LIFEGUARD TRAINING

Lifeguard Training Course Objective

The American Red Cross Lifeguarding course provides entry-level lifeguard participants with the knowledge and skills to prevent, recognize, and respond to aquatic emergencies; provide professional-level care for breathing and cardiac emergencies; and treat injuries and sudden illnesses until emergency medical services (EMS) personnel take over. 

Candidate Prerequisites

Lifeguard candidates must meet the following prerequisite requirements to be eligible to participate in the Lifeguard Training Course.

1. Be at least 15 years old on or before the final scheduled session of the course.

2. Swim 150 yards, continuously demonstrating breath control and rhythmic breathing, tread water for two minutes using only legs, continue swimming for an additional 50 yards. Candidates may swim using the front crawl, breaststroke or a combination of both, but swimming on the back or side is not allowed. Swim goggles may be used.

3. Complete a timed event within 1 minute, 40 seconds:

~ Starting in the water, swim 20 yards. Swim goggles are not allowed.

~ Surface dive, feet-first or headfirst, to a depth of 7 to 10 feet to retrieve a 10-pound object.

~ Return to the surface and swim 20 yards on the back to return to the starting point with both hands holding the object and keeping the face at or near the surface so they are able to get a breath.

o Exit the water without using a ladder or steps.
